如何实现以太网监控的跨平台兼容?
在当今信息化时代,以太网监控已成为企业网络管理的重要组成部分。然而,由于不同平台之间的差异,如何实现以太网监控的跨平台兼容成为了一个亟待解决的问题。本文将深入探讨如何实现以太网监控的跨平台兼容,为读者提供有益的参考。
一、跨平台兼容的挑战
- 操作系统差异
不同操作系统(如Windows、Linux、macOS等)对网络协议、驱动程序等方面的支持存在差异,这给以太网监控的跨平台兼容带来了挑战。
- 硬件设备差异
不同硬件设备(如交换机、路由器等)的网络性能、功能支持等方面存在差异,这也影响了以太网监控的跨平台兼容。
- 网络协议差异
不同平台可能采用不同的网络协议,如TCP/IP、UDP等,这使得以太网监控在跨平台时需要考虑协议转换问题。
二、实现跨平台兼容的策略
- 采用通用网络协议
为确保以太网监控的跨平台兼容,建议采用通用网络协议,如TCP/IP。通用协议能够降低不同平台之间的兼容性问题。
- 开发跨平台监控软件
针对不同操作系统,开发相应的监控软件,实现统一界面和功能。以下是一些跨平台监控软件的例子:
- Wireshark:一款开源的网络协议分析工具,支持Windows、Linux、macOS等多个平台。
- Nagios:一款开源的网络监控工具,支持Windows、Linux、macOS等多个平台。
- 采用虚拟化技术
通过虚拟化技术,将不同操作系统部署在同一硬件设备上,实现跨平台兼容。例如,使用VMware、VirtualBox等虚拟化软件。
- 利用云平台
将监控数据上传至云平台,通过云平台实现跨平台监控。云平台可以提供统一的监控界面和功能,降低跨平台兼容性问题。
- 针对硬件设备进行适配
针对不同硬件设备,开发相应的驱动程序和监控工具,确保以太网监控的跨平台兼容。
三、案例分析
某企业采用Wireshark进行网络监控,该软件支持Windows、Linux、macOS等多个平台,实现了跨平台兼容。
某企业采用Nagios进行网络监控,该工具支持Windows、Linux、macOS等多个平台,降低了跨平台兼容性问题。
四、总结
实现以太网监控的跨平台兼容,需要综合考虑操作系统、硬件设备、网络协议等因素。通过采用通用网络协议、开发跨平台监控软件、利用虚拟化技术和云平台等策略,可以有效解决跨平台兼容问题。在实际应用中,企业应根据自身需求选择合适的跨平台兼容方案,确保网络监控的稳定性和可靠性。
猜你喜欢:全链路监控